Reflections at Lock 10, Audlem Locks, this includes what looks like the old lock keepers housing.
Through a series of 15 locks the canal level is rained by 30 meters as you head south from Audlem, Cheshire to Market Drayton in Staffordshire

Fradley Junction is a canal junction between Fradley and Alrewas near Lichfield, Staffordshire, England and the point at which the Coventry Canal joins the Trent and Mersey Canal. Guelph’s Covered Bridge is a landmark crossing the Speed River. This magnificent lattice bridge was built in 1992 by over 400 volunteers from the Timber Framers Guild. In the glow of sunset on June 29, 2016, an eastbound BNSF grain empty passes the tall cliffs rimming Lombard, Montana. In a couple of hours, the innocent-looking clouds will build into impressive thunderstorms flashing over the ghost town, while Montana Rail Link tonnage continues to roll through the night.

The temple has several features to be appreciated. The main complex houses ten thousand miniature gold Buddhas. The Buddhas are housed on shelves throughout the complex. The grounds also host a seven story stupa utilizing authentic Chinese architecture. But the real treat lies within the stupa, a 5 story tall bronze statue of Buddha. In the heart of the old town, the Palais de l'Isle, a former prison and Palais de Justice (law courts), is today home to the Annecy History museum. Near this symbolic building of the 12th century, the Sainte-Claire street is also an unmissable place during the visit for its beautiful arcaded houses. Towering over the town, the museum-castle, former residence of the counts of Geneva and the dukes of Genevois-Nemours, is dedicated to archaeology, ethnology, art, history and alpine lakes.
